ABSTRACT
This paper discusses the development, implementation and
application of numerical schemes for modelling the effects of temperature-dependent
material properties including chemical shrinkage and thermal expansion of resin on the
curing of thermosetting composites in pultrusion. The results of the three-dimensional
simulation of heat and mass transfer in pultrusion of regular as well as irregular and
hollow sections are presented.
